The Scholarship & Social Justice Undergraduate Research Conference will be held virtually on April 8th & 9th, 2021, featuring undergraduate researchers from seventeen different public and private universities across the nation. Since 2015, this conference has welcomed undergraduate students, faculty, and staff together to celebrate scholarship that furthers social justice, and reflective learning. It is one of the only national research conferences for undergraduate researchers. To highlight exemplars in this area, three scholars recognized for their integration of civic engagement and scholarship, Dr. Enrique Murillo of California State University, San Bernadino; Dr. Cristina Santamaría Graff, Assistant Professor of Special Education, Urban Teacher Education, Department of Education, Indiana University–Purdue University Indianapolis, Dr. Eric Galm, Professor of Music and Ethnomusicology, Trinity College will be joining us on a faculty panel. We are also honored to have Dr. Roberto Gonzalez, Professor of Education, Harvard Graduate School of Education, author of Lives in Limbo, as our keynote speaker.
